Breunei : ASEAN Stamp 2024

The content presents the significance of the General Post Office (GPO) in Brunei Darussalam, which marks the beginnings of organized postal services since 1874. Officially established in 1906 during British protection, Brunei joined the Straits Settlements Local Postal Union that same year. The GPO building, completed in 1952, symbolizes postal administration and national development, being located near key government landmarks. Brunei became a member of the Universal Postal Union in 1985, enhancing its international postal connections. The GPO is not only pivotal for mail services but also hosts a stamp gallery showcasing the nation's philatelic heritage and history.

Thailand : ASEAN Stamp 2024

On August 8, 2024, Thailand's issuing a 20 Baht commemorative stamp for ASEAN 2024. It features a cool watercolor design of the General Post Office with the ASEAN logo. It’s 48 x 30 mm, printed in multi-color with a spot UV finish. The first-day cover costs 33 Baht.
